Block

#20,853,411
Block Number
20,853,411 @ 02/09/2025, 01:02:40
Status
Finalized
ID
0x013e32a3e0e66d163703895f3cabef17a8d2a455eecd8f90d1a921a8162eae6c
Transactions
Gas Used
3456112/40000000 (8.64% Used)
Total Score
2,035,881,860 (+98)
Rewards
14.70 VTHO